What's the Big News About Financial Support?
You know, in the world of business, there are these moments that really stand out, like when a company gets a big boost of financial support. We're talking about a significant step forward for a company called Caronsale, which, you know, is a really big player in the digital auction space for used cars across Europe. It’s almost like they just got a major vote of confidence, a huge push to help them do even more of what they do best. This particular round of investment, a Series C growth investment, brought in a rather impressive sum of €70 million, which is a lot of money to help a company grow and expand its reach. This kind of financial backing is pretty essential for businesses that want to make a bigger mark.
So, this whole effort was actually led by a group called Northzone, which, you know, is a well-known name in the investment world. It really shows that some serious players believe in what Caronsale is building. This German company, Caronsale, is basically a digital marketplace where businesses can buy and sell used cars to other businesses. It's not like your typical car dealership, but more like a sophisticated online hub where these transactions happen. They've just successfully wrapped up this €70 million Series C round, and the main goal is to help them spread out even further across the various markets in Europe. It's all about making their platform available to more people and businesses, you see, making it a more widespread solution for trading cars.
This fresh funding, you know, is going to do a lot of good for Caronsale. It will help them really speed up their plans to expand all over Europe, getting into more countries and connecting with more businesses. It’s also going to allow them to make their product and service offerings even better, like adding new features or making the whole experience smoother for their users. And, arguably, a very big part of it is to really cement their spot as the top digital marketplace for business-to-business used car trading. It’s about not just growing, but also making sure they stay at the very front of the pack, which, you know, is a pretty important goal for any business looking to lead in its field.

Exploring a Misunderstood Mental Health Condition
So, too it's almost as if some topics, especially in the area of mental well-being, tend to get a bit tangled up in misunderstandings, wouldn't you say? One such topic is dissociative identity disorder, or DID. It's a rather uncommon situation where a person might experience having two or more distinct ways of being, or different personality states, that are present within them. These different ways of being, you know, can actually take turns being in control of the individual at various times. It’s a very complex way the mind can work, and because it's not something most people encounter every day, it often leads to a lot of questions and, frankly, some incorrect ideas about what it really is.
DID is actually considered a mental health condition where, as we said, you have these two or more separate identities. It can sometimes be a way for a person to, like, create a distance from really tough or negative experiences they might have gone through. It’s almost as if the mind finds a way to cope with things that are too much to handle all at once, by compartmentalizing them into different parts. This condition, you know, has a history, too; it was once more widely known by a different name, which was multiple personality disorder, until around 1994 when the name was changed to better reflect what was being observed and understood about it. This change in name, you see, was part of a broader effort to be more precise in how we talk about these kinds of experiences.
The thing is, DID is, in some respects, one of the most misunderstood psychiatric disorders out there. There's a lot of information floating around that isn't quite right, and that can lead to people having the wrong idea about it, or even, you know, feeling a sense of shame or judgment. That's why it's really important to address these misconceptions with solid, well-researched information. The goal, actually, is to spread a more accurate understanding and, just as importantly, to help reduce any negative feelings or stigma that people might attach to the condition. It’s about bringing clarity to a topic that has often been shrouded in confusion, which, you know, is a really worthwhile endeavor for everyone involved.
Why Do We Need a Clear "Overview" of DID?
You know, having a clear "overview" of something like DID is really important because, frankly, without it, people tend to fill in the gaps with their own ideas, which are often based on what they've seen in movies or on TV, and that's not always accurate. Most people who experience DID have, unfortunately, gone through repetitive and very difficult childhood trauma. This can include things like physical abuse, sexual abuse, emotional neglect, and growing up in a home environment that was, you know, quite dysfunctional. These early experiences can have a very profound impact on how a person's mind develops and copes with stress, which is why a proper understanding of the causes is so vital.
DID is a disorder that is very much associated with severe behavioral health symptoms. These aren't just small things; they can really affect a person's daily life, their relationships, and their overall well-being. Because it was previously known as multiple personality disorder, there's still a lot of lingering confusion from that older term. People often have an image in their heads that doesn't quite match what the condition actually entails, and that's where a good, solid overview comes in handy. It helps to clear away the old ideas and replace them with a more current and correct understanding, which, you know, is always a good thing when it comes to health matters.
So, the condition involves the presence of two or more distinct identities, or personality states. It's not about someone pretending or putting on an act; it's a very real and often distressing experience for the individual. The identities can be quite different from each other, sometimes having different memories, ways of speaking, or even physical mannerisms. This can lead to what's described as identity and reality disruption, where a person might feel disconnected from themselves or their surroundings. A comprehensive look at DID helps us see these complexities for what they are, rather than simplifying them into something they're not, which, you know, is pretty essential for anyone trying to learn about it.
